Episode 728 | Bootstrapping Gymdesk to a More Than $32.5M Exit

In episode 728, Rob Walling interviews Eran Galperin, founder of Gymdesk, about his incredible exit. Eran shares his journey of transforming Gymdesk from "Martial Arts on Rails" into a successful gym management software company. He discusses how they succeeded in a competitive market, the role of TinySeed in their growth, and how feelings of burnout eventually led to a majority buyout for the company.

Topics we cover:

  • 2:02 – Gymdesk Announces a $32.5 Million Strategic Growth Investment
  • 5:13 – How the investment will be used
  • 6:38 – Eran’s projects before Gymdesk
  • 9:21 – Sticking with one idea long enough to see success
  • 12:45 – Entering a competitive market
  • 16:37 – Rapid growth as a marketing leader
  • 20:54 – Dealing with burnout and entertaining an acquisition
  • 26:45 – Handling a stressful sales process
  • 32:19 – The future of Gymdesk
